Sheffield to make CCTV cameras in taxis mandatory


Taxi drivers in Sheffield will have to install CCTV cameras in their cars at a cost of about £500 each.

Sheffield City Council said cameras in taxis and private hire cabs would help reduce abuse and violent attacks.

Out of 2,224 taxis in Sheffield, the council said 128 currently have CCTV installed.

Hafeas Rehman, chairman of the Sheffield Taxi Trade Association (STTA), said cameras help drivers, but "shouldn't be mandatory".

"We're all adults. If anyone feels it will enhance their safety they should install one, but not have it actually forced on you just because people think it's a good idea," he said.

Chairman of the council's licensing committee, Councillor John Robson, said a mandatory policy was "definitely needed" and the results of a trial in 2007 were "overwhelmingly amazing":

"One in seven fares prior to the trial resulted in an incident - whether that was verbal abuse, threats of violence, physical assault, a dispute over the fare, people running off without paying or damage to the taxi.

"During the trial that figure reduced to less than one in 100. Surely the figures speak for themselves," he said.

A council report said systems that would meet their requirements for safety and recording duration start from around £500.

Legal test for Sheffield taxis CCTV plan


DRIVERS of black cabs could take Sheffield Council to court over a decision ordering them to fit CCTV cameras in their taxis.

Sheffield Council’s licensing committee has decided that all Hackney carriages should have cameras fitted at a cost of £500 per vehicle to ‘protect public safety’.

The committee, chaired by Labour councillor John Robson, said the cameras were needed to protect drivers from assaults and also ensure security of passengers.

But the decision has angered members of Sheffield Taxi Trade Association, which represents drivers.

Hafeas Rehman, the organisation’s chairman, said: “We believe the idea of compulsory CCTV cameras is a step too far and are looking into taking the council to court for a judicial review of its decision.

“Taxi drivers should be allowed to decide if they want to install cameras to protect them - but the other reason given by the council is insulting to drivers.

“There have been a very small number of incidents where passengers have been sexually assaulted but forcing us all to fit cameras makes it look like we are not to be trusted.

“The expense also comes after we have been refused permission to increase fares to cope with rising fuel and insurance costs.

“The CCTV system the council wants us to introduce is ridiculous. It would switch on the moment we turn the ignition and stay working for 45 minutes after we have finished driving.”

Sheffield Council said a further meeting would take place with drivers in May to discuss how to implement the new policy.
